Embattled Broward Election Supervisor Announces Possible Retirement.
Broward County Elections Supervisor Brenda Snipes (shown
above right) announced that she might retire from her post on Tuesday
amid a major ballot controversy in her county.
Florida closed the polls just as every other state did after the midterm elections on November 5.
But the Sunshine State has remained in the fight with a recount effort well underway.
Broward County helped to trigger the highly controversial recount by
finding additional uncounted ballots after the deadline came due to
submit them. And some critics have alleged voter fraud in response.
